Output cd0e85615289d87b60a6dfd43868481b27c599193131ebef4673e36ea5dc79fa:2

value
244230000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ab61b753833f4f51122172353f4018cbabc330e9 OP_EQUAL
address
MPXLqfhjkz7vHUgttvMKtwWwmc4eCQ3hgy
transaction
cd0e85615289d87b60a6dfd43868481b27c599193131ebef4673e36ea5dc79fa
spent
true